The Shift Toward Authenticity in Consumer Relations
Over the last decade, the digital landscape has undergone a paradigm shift. Where once marketers could rely solely on aspirational advertising, today’s consumers seek validation from their peers and credible sources. According to recent industry surveys, approximately 85% of consumers trust online reviews as much as personal recommendations, underscoring the paramount importance of authentic feedback (Source: Digital Consumer Insights, 2023).
This transition is rooted in the desire for transparency. Consumers are increasingly skeptical of branded messages that seem overly curated or promotional. They gravitate toward honest assessments—both positive and negative—to inform their purchasing decisions. This is especially evident in sectors such as e-commerce, hospitality, and professional services, where trustworthiness directly correlates with conversion rates.
Why Honest Feedback Matters for Digital Brands
| Benefit | Description |
|---|---|
| Credibility | Transparent sharing of customer experiences bolsters brand credibility, fostering a reputation for honesty and integrity. |
| Customer Engagement | Authentic feedback encourages dialogue, creating a two-way communication channel that deepens consumer involvement. |
| Product Improvement | Constructive criticism from customers provides insights that guide product development and service refinement. |
| SEO Benefits | Reviews and real user content improve search visibility and foster user-generated content, essential for modern SEO strategies. |

Best Practices for Collecting and Utilizing Honest Feedback
Creating a Culture of Transparency
Brands must foster an environment where customers feel safe and encouraged to share genuine experiences. This includes actively requesting feedback and publicly demonstrating responsiveness.
Implementing Structured Feedback Mechanisms
- Post-purchase surveys with open-ended questions
- Dedicated review sections on websites
- Engagement through social media conversations
